EPILEPTIC SEIZURES IN A DISCRETE MODEL OF NEURAL NETWORKS OF THE BRAIN

    https://doi.org/10.1142/S0129183199000632Cited by:5 (Source: Crossref)

    A discrete model of a neural network of excitatory and inhibitory neurons is presented which yields oscillations of its global activity. Different types of dynamics occur depending on the selection of parameters: oscillating population activity as well as randomly fluctuating but mainly constant activity. For certain sets of parameters the model also shows temporary transitions from apparently random to periodic behavior in one run, similar to an epileptic seizure.
